- Esistono diversi metodi per eseguire o installare programmi su Windows senza un installatore tradizionale.
- L'utilizzo di software portatili e tecniche di accesso remoto semplifica la gestione su più computer.
- Strumenti avanzati, come PSExec e PowerShell, consentono installazioni automatiche e remote.
Ti è mai capitato di imbatterti in un programma che non include il classico installer e di chiederti come utilizzarlo sul tuo computer Windows? Questa è una situazione più comune di quanto sembri, soprattutto quando si scaricano applicazioni avanzate, strumenti open source o utility portatili. Al giorno d'oggi, sapere come utilizzarlo è importante per sapere come installarlo. Quali passaggi bisogna seguire per installare manualmente un programma in Windows senza usare il consueto programma di installazione? Si tratta di un'abilità molto utile sia per gli utenti esperti che per quelli meno esperti. per i principianti che cercano di sfruttare al meglio il loro sistema operativo.
In questo articolo spiego in modo chiaro e dettagliato come puoi Installare applicazioni su Windows anche se non dispongono di un programma di installazione tradizionale, le diverse opzioni disponibili, Tricks per farlo dall'interfaccia grafica o tramite la riga di comando comandie persino come farlo da remoto su altri computer. Esamineremo anche alcuni problemi comuni e soluzioni pratiche, oltre a suggerimenti aggiuntivi per semplificare l'intero processo. Non perdetevelo perché sicuramente finirete per usare uno di questi metodi prima di quanto pensiate!
Perché alcuni programmi non includono un programma di installazione?
Prima di entrare nelle tecniche, è importante capire Perché ci sono programmi che non richiedono l'installazione tradizionaleMolti sviluppatori, soprattutto nel mondo del software libero e delle applicazioni Portátiles, offrono versioni compresse in zip, rar o cartelle con file eseguibili e file associatiL'obiettivo è quello di facilitare l'uso immediato, consentendo l'esecuzione dei programmi da un USB ed evitare di modificare il registro di Windows o di toccare i file di sistema. Pertanto, Non tutti i programmi devono passare attraverso il classico “Avanti, Avanti, Fine” e può funzionare perfettamente in modalità portatile.
Come eseguire programmi senza installarli in Windows
Il modo più semplice per utilizzare un programma senza un programma di installazione è semplicemente decomprimere il file scaricato (solitamente .zip o .rar) in una cartella sul tuo computer e cerca l'eseguibile principale, solitamente con estensione .exeBasta fare doppio clic su quel file e, se tutto è in ordine, il programma si avvierà senza lasciare alcuna traccia profonda nel sistema.
Per comodità, puoi creare un collegamento all'eseguibileFai clic destro su di esso, seleziona "Invia a" e poi "Desktop (crea collegamento)". In questo modo, avrai il programma sempre a portata di mano e potrai aggiungerlo alla barra delle applicazioni o al menu Start per accedervi rapidamente, proprio come qualsiasi altra applicazione installata in modo tradizionale.
Soluzioni se il programma non compare nel motore di ricerca di Windows
Quando si eseguono applicazioni che non hanno superato il processo di installazione standard, è comune che La ricerca di Windows non rileva quei programmi portatiliIl motivo principale è che le posizioni in cui si trovano questi programmi non sono incluse nell'indice di ricerca utilizzato dal sistema.
Per risolvere questo problema e riuscire a cercare facilmente i programmi dal menu Start, segui questi passaggi:
- Apri il Pannello di controllo (potrebbe essere utile selezionare la visualizzazione tramite icone piccole).
- Clicca su Opzioni di indicizzazione.
- Premere Cambiare e nella finestra che appare, seleziona la casella relativa alla cartella in cui si trova il programma portabile.
Una volta indicizzato, Windows Search troverà l'eseguibile digitandone il nome. Questo trucco è particolarmente utile per chi lavora spesso con più applicazioni portatili.
Aggiorna o sostituisci manualmente le versioni portatili
Un grande vantaggio dei programmi senza installazione è che Aggiornare o modificare le versioni è estremamente semplice.. Semplicemente Download Per installare la versione più recente, decomprimi il contenuto e sostituisci la vecchia cartella con quella nuova. In questo modo, avrai la certezza di avere sempre la versione più recente e, se il programma memorizza le sue impostazioni in file all'interno della stessa cartella, non perderai le tue preferenze.
Molti utenti scelgono questo metodo per applicazioni quali lettori multimediali, editor e piccole utility.Tra i suoi vantaggi c'è il fatto che non lascia tracce nel registro di sistema, né riempie Windows di file residui dopo disinstallare i programmi, che aiuta a mantenere il computer più pulito e veloce.
Installazione remota di programmi su altri computer
In ambienti professionali o quando si gestiscono più computer, può sorgere la necessità di installare programmi manualmente e da remotoEsistono diversi metodi per raggiungere questo obiettivo, ognuno con i propri vantaggi e requisiti tecnici. I metodi più utili e aggiornati sono descritti di seguito.
Metodo 1: utilizzare il software di controllo remoto con GUI
Se non si dispone di esperienza tecnica avanzata, il modo più conveniente per installare le applicazioni in remoto è utilizzare strumenti di controllo remoto con un'interfaccia grafica, come AnyViewerQuesto tipo di software ti consente prendere il controllo completo di un altro computer tramite Internet, accedendo al desktop come se ci fossi seduto davanti. In questo modo, puoi scaricare, eseguire programmi e lavorare normalmente sul computer remoto.
- Installare AnyViewer (o un altro software simile) su entrambi i computer.
- Crea un account e assegna i dispositivi al tuo account.
- Dal tuo PC, seleziona il computer remoto e connettiti con un solo clic.
- Una volta dentro, scarica il programma portatile o installalo manualmente proprio come fai sul tuo computer.
Questo metodo è perfetto se hai bisogno di assistere altri o gestire più team senza dover viaggiare fisicamente. Inoltre, consente l'accesso da cellulare come i telefoni Android o iPhone, il che aggiunge molta flessibilità.
Metodo 2: utilizzo di PSExec per installazioni remote avanzate
Per coloro che cercano maggiore automazione e controllo, PSExec È uno strumento avanzato fornito da Sysinternals (Microsoft) che consente di eseguire programmi e comandi su macchine remote sulla stessa rete, senza la necessità di installare software aggiuntivi su tali macchine.
- Scarica PSExec dal sito Web ufficiale di Microsoft ed estrarne l'eseguibile in una cartella (ad esempio C:\SysinternalsSuite\).
- Preparare il pacchetto del programma che vuoi installare, preferibilmente nel formato MSI (anche se alcuni programmi di installazione exe potrebbero funzionare se supportano la modalità silenziosa).
- Configurare il firewall sulla macchina remota per consentire il traffico SMB-In (porta TCP 445), necessario per il trasferimento e l'esecuzione remoti.
- apre CMD come amministratore sul computer locale e copia il file MSI sul computer remoto utilizzando un comando come:
Copia c:\users\username\downloads\program.msi \REMOTEPCNAME\C$ - Per semplificare l'esecuzione dei comandi, modifica la directory nella console impostandola sulla cartella PSExec.
- Avviare il programma di installazione sul computer remoto con:
PsExec.exe \REMOTEPCNAME -i -s msiexec.exe /i «C:\percorso\programma.msi» /qn /norestart
In questo modo il software verrà installato in modo silenzioso, senza alcun intervento diretto.
Questo metodo è molto utile nelle reti aziendali o quando è necessario installare software su più computer senza doversi spostare. Puoi anche consultare Come ripristinare l'installazione del driver in Windows per comprendere meglio la gestione dei conducenti in questi processi.
Metodo 3: installazione remota tramite PowerShell
Un'altra alternativa comune è Utilizzare PowerShell per eseguire comandi o installare programmi su altri computerSebbene offra molta flessibilità, bisogna fare attenzione perché alcuni programmi di installazione potrebbero non terminare correttamente se copione continua a funzionare dopo aver avviato l'installazione.
- Apri PowerShell come amministratore dal menu Start.
- Esegui un comando come:
Invoke-Command -ComputerName computerName -ScriptBlock { c:\path\program.exe /silent }
Questo comando consente di avviare installazioni silenziose sul computer remoto, ma è importante tenere presente che non tutti i programmi di installazione supportano questa modalità e che esiste il rischio di annullamento se il processo principale termina prematuramente. Per maggiori dettagli, vedere Come creare un ambiente di installazione automatica in Windows 11.
Metodo 4: distribuire il software tramite Criteri di gruppo (GPO)
Nelle organizzazioni con Active Directory, è molto semplice distribuire programmi in massa su tutti i computer della rete utilizzando criteri di gruppoAffinché ciò funzioni, il programma di installazione deve essere in formato MSI e i computer devono avere accesso in sola lettura a una cartella condivisa.
- Dal server, creare una cartella condivisa e posizionarvi il file MSI.
- Concede i permessi di lettura a tutti gli utenti del dominio.
- Aprire “Utenti e computer di Active Directory” e creare un nuovo criterio di gruppo.
- Configurare quali computer o utenti riceveranno la policy.
- Nell'editor dei criteri, selezionare Installazione software e immettere il percorso completo del pacchetto MSI.
- Salvare le modifiche e, dopo un riavvio, i client installeranno automaticamente il software assegnato.
Questo sistema è perfetto per gli ambienti aziendali, consentendo di installare, aggiornare o rimuovere programmi in modo centralizzato e senza l'intervento manuale dell'utente. Per una gestione efficace, è anche possibile consultare Come aggiornare Office manualmente.
Scrittore appassionato del mondo dei byte e della tecnologia in generale. Adoro condividere le mie conoscenze attraverso la scrittura, ed è quello che farò in questo blog, mostrarti tutte le cose più interessanti su gadget, software, hardware, tendenze tecnologiche e altro ancora. Il mio obiettivo è aiutarti a navigare nel mondo digitale in modo semplice e divertente.